The place in which Pondweed makes his home is certainly visually impressive - as you approach it, you are greeted with the warm glow of lanterns, as well as heady aromas as you come closer. Pondweed is always welcoming to visitors - even dragons he's never met before - and he is quick to offer various herbal concoctions as "remedies" to any illness you may have.

Of course, while some dragons come to him for help with headaches or mild pains, those in the know like to visit for more recreational purposes. Certain herbs and minerals, when either smoked or digested, can produce a variety of elevating - usually calming - sensations. Dragon digestive systems are quite interesting and developed, of course, and Pondweed is constantly experimenting with various different herbs to achieve desired effects.

Some look down on this practice, but Pondweed's knowledge around plants is undeniable. On numerous occasions he has provided antidotes for unfortunate poisoned or otherwise afflicted dragons, and so the more prim dragons in the clan turn a blind eye to his other activities.
